Ethylenecarbonate CAS:96-49-1
In industrial applications, ethylene carbonate is utilized as a solvent in the production of lithium batteries, serving as an electrolyte additive to improve the performance and safety of the battery. It also finds use as a solvent and plasticizer in the manufacturing of polymers and resins. Furthermore, ethylene carbonate is employed as a chemical intermediate in the synthesis of pharmaceuticals, agrochemicals, and other specialty chemicals. Its ability to react with a variety of compounds makes it valuable in organic synthesis processes. In addition, ethylene carbonate is utilized in the field of electronics as a solvent for electrolytes in supercapacitors and as a component in electrolyte formulations for capacitors and other electronic devices. Moreover, ethylene carbonate is used in the production of coatings, adhesives, and sealants, where it serves as a solvent and a component in formulations to improve the performance and properties of the final product. Overall, ethylene carbonate's versatile properties make it a valuable compound in various industrial processes, contributing to the production of a wide range of products essential to modern technology and manufacturing.
